#ed495c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ed495c is composed of 92.9% red, 28.6%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.2% magenta, 61.2%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 353 degrees, a saturation of 82% and a lightness of 60.8%. #ed495c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ff92b8 with #db0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

Shades and Tints of #ed495c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0103 is the darkest color, while #fffc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#ed495c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a09697 is the less saturated color, while #fc3a50 is the most saturated one.
